Type: Art Museums
Description: The collection of over 100,000 pieces contains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ander art, as well as Australian, Asian and international works.

We joined the free one-hour highlights tour, and our volunteer guide took us around and told us the stories behind their pieces of art. We started in the aboriginal section. I was surprised commercial Aboriginal art has only been around since the 1970's. Before that, their art was more for ceremonial purposes and done on bark or body art. Also... More

A large modern building on the edge of Lake Burley Griffin, the NGA is a must for any local or visitor to Canberra. The static and visiting exhibitions are world class, although the major international visiting exhibitions usually attract an additional cost for admission which is a shame. The Gallery has a very good coffee shop/restaurant in very bright surroundings... More
